Animal Identification and Traceability in Transport
Ensuring that livestock transportation is efficient and humane involves having robust systems for animal identification and traceability. This importance is highlighted by regulations which require detailed record-keeping to track the movement of animals throughout the transport process. The implementation of such systems can greatly enhance biosecurity by quickly pinpointing affected animals in the event of disease outbreaks. Proper documentation that accompanies the animals, including health certificates and transport records, allows for better management of livestock during their journey. Specific identification methods like microchipping, ear tagging, or RFID technology provide unique identifiers. These identifiers can help trace the animals’ origins, health status, and subsequent movement through the supply chain. Reliable identification can safeguard animal welfare during transport and is imperative for quality assurance for consumers as well. Regulatory Framework and Compliance
As governments worldwide impose stricter regulations, particularly in the European Union and the United States, ensuring adherence to animal transport guidelines has become vital. Regulatory frameworks require that livestock be clearly identified and their movements documented throughout the entire transportation process. These regulations aim to protect animal welfare, improve food safety, and enhance disease control measures. Transporters are therefore obligated to maintain a record that includes the animal’s identification number, origin, destination, and health status. Such records are reviewed during inspections, emphasizing the need for accuracy and compliance. Failure to comply with these regulations can lead to substantial penalties, including fines and restrictions on operations. Consequently, livestock operators need to regularly inspect their practices to ensure they meet these guidelines effectively. In this context, technology plays an integral role in enhancing compliance and operational efficiency. The advent of innovative solutions allows transport companies to implement electronic systems that automate the documentation process. For instance, cloud-based platforms can store and share information in real time, making it easier for stakeholders to access and validate records. Mobile applications designed specifically for livestock transport enable operators to document animal identification details swiftly. These systems not only reduce human error but also facilitate quicker responses to regulatory inquiries or audits. Furthermore, gathering data related to transportation practices can play an essential role in continuous improvement. By analyzing historical transport data, stakeholders can identify patterns and potential areas for enhancement. Consideration of factors such as transport duration, animal behavior, and environmental conditions can lead to actionable insights. For instance, if data indicates that certain transportation routes consistently lead to stress in animals, it can prompt revisions in routing decisions to avoid those paths. Similarly, insights derived from transport success can promote the use of best practices.
